Abstract
The concept of Chemical Subsystem of the Innovative System for Detecting Hidden People in Transport (CHS-ISDHPT) is one of three subsystems of the Mobile Operating Platform (MOP-ISDHPT). The MOP-ISDHPT will be used to increase the detection of illegal smuggling of people. The chemical subsystem will consist of: a transport platform, a sample conditioning system, a gas chromatograph coupled with an ion-mobility spectrometer (GC-IMS), and a data integrator. Two concepts of CHS-ISDHPT development are considered, differing in the location of the GC-IMS installation. Apart from the location of the GC-IMS, both concepts differ in the method of measurement, ease of use, detection limit, and exposure of the analytical equipment to environmental conditions.
